The Inside Swing

Conway Farms Golf Club

Chicago, Illinois

A Tom Fazio design in Lake Forest that hosted the 2013 BMW Championship, Conway Farms proves that compelling championship golf doesn't require 7,400+ yards. The walking-only, caddie-program club emphasizes strategic variety and firm, fast conditions.

History & Heritage

Conway Farms Golf Club opened in 1991 in Lake Forest on Chicago's North Shore. Tom Fazio designed the course with Scottish links influences. The club adopted a walking-only policy with a full caddie program from inception.

Conway Farms hosted the BMW Championship in 2013, 2015, and 2017. Zach Johnson won the inaugural 2013 edition. The club also hosted the 2009 Western Amateur and regularly ranks among the top 10 courses in Illinois.

What to Expect

Conway Farms is a walking-only experience with a mandatory caddie program. The Fazio design plays to 7,139 yards at par 70 with strategic variety.

Firm, fast conditions and Scottish links influence are hallmarks of the design.

Playing Tips

At par 70, birdie chances are limited. Wind off Lake Michigan is a significant factor. Lean on your caddie for local knowledge.
